Responsibilities
As an apprentice chef at Toms you will be given the opportunity to progress through the stations of the kitchen whilst gaining a good understanding of food preparation, kitchen management and fundamental practises to develop as a team member and an individual chef.
Training will be paramount in importance to restaurant service. However, these development milestones will progress each skill sets simultaneously.
You will be expected to work as part of a team producing a high volume of food whilst sticking to Tom's key principals of provenance, quality and sustainability.
Duties will include but are not limited to:
- Work as part of the restaurant team
- Assist in food preparation for restaurant service
- Assist in service of food
- Develop into running an individual section of the kitchen
- Help with cleanliness of the kitchen
- Have creative input in menus and dish development working alongside the team to come up with seasonal inspiration for the menu
- Help maintain legal compliance in the kitchen by having an understanding of food safety
You would be contracted to 5 days a week including one day at college and with hard work and perseverance, will become a core part of the team.
As this is an Apprenticeship, you will also attend Exeter College one day a week, learning all aspects of the Commis Chef role. This will include the following topics:
- Culinary
- Food safety
- People
- Business

Qualifications Required
You will ideally have achieved a grade C/4 in maths and English at GCSE.
You will still be considered for this role if you do not meet the entry criteria, however, you will have to complete Functional Skills alongside your Apprenticeship.
Training Provided
Apprentices will be working towards achievement of the following:
- Certification of Commis Chef Apprenticeship Standard Level 2
- Level 1 Functional Skills in English and maths (where applicable)
